About this episode

The episode discusses the upcoming San Francisco propositions C and D regarding corporate taxation and features a debate between key stakeholders.

Civic Special - San Franciscans will decide on June 2nd whether to tax corporations whose CEOs make 100 times the median salary of their lowest paid workers or raise a more modest tax on larger businesses. San Francisco Public Press Executive Director Lila LaHood moderated the discussion between David Harrison, Director of Public Policy For the San Francisco Chamber of Commerce and Kim Tavaglione, Executive Director of the San Francisco Labor Council at KALW radio’s public space in downtown San Francisco.
